Cultural relics from 800-year-old ship on display in E China

More than 100 cultural relics from "Huaguangjiao No.1", a ship that sank 800 years ago, are on display at Nanjing Museum in Nanjing, capital of East China's Jiangsu province, on April 24, 2016. The vessel belonged to the Southern Song Dynasty (1127-1279). [Photo/Chinanews.com]

The ancient commercial ship was discovered accidentally by local fishermen in 1996, and its underwater excavation was of great significance as it unearthed nearly 1,000 ceramic objects. Later, ship was also lifted from the water.

The cultural relics and remains from the ship reveal China's trade with foreign countries along the ancient Maritime Silk Road.
